Last night I made up this one:
In a Waffle bowl, throw ~12 salted cashews, drizzle liberally with honey, add 2 scoops Breyers Vanilla, drizzle liberally with Magic Shell chocolate coating, allow to melt slightly, enjoy!

My treat is to take a Flour tortilla, microwave it till it bubbles up and steams.

Take it out of the microwave drop a couple of scoop's of quality vanilla ice cream on top of the tortilla.

Dust with Cinnamon, drizzle with a spoonful of dark honeySmileWavy

Variations of this add fresh fruit
